ROM REDDY CALLS FOR CHANGES TO SENATE SENIORITY SYSTEM (Charleston, SC) - Rom Reddy, the most conservative Republican candidate for governor, businessman, founder of DOGESC and seven figure donor to President Donald J Trump today issued the following statement: The way the South Carolina Senate operates is a perfect example of why government is broken. Committee chairmen are not chosen based on ability, leadership, vision or results. They are assigned based solely on seniority. That makes no sense and is the primary reason we have the roach motel syndrome - bills check in but don’t check out. Citizens are frustrated and the status quo for special interests preserved. In the real world, in the private sector, you do not put someone in charge of a division or a company just because they have been there the longest. You choose leaders based on their ability to lead. Or else you end up with complacent losers who don't care to see change when change is needed and cannot be ousted when they refuse to do their job. Government should be no different. When I am elected governor, I will use my influence to push the S.C. Senate to change chairmanship rules when they return for the 2027 session. Committees should elect their own chairmen. Chairmen should have an expiration date- my preference is two years consecutively, however I'm amenable to four years to align with senatorial terms. Leadership should be earned, not handed out based on time served. Right now this broken system allows one person controlled by special interests to stop the will of the people. That kind of centralized power is called tyranny and exactly what our founders fought to prevent. One or two individuals should not be be able to shape the agenda for the state. For example: Luke Rankin is the chairman of the Senate Judiciary Committee, not because he was chosen as the best leader, but because he is the most senior member of the Republican Party when everyone knows that this one time Democrat is one of the most liberal members of the entire General Assembly. Because of this appointment Rankin routinely exercises his power to block legislation that the people of South Carolina overwhelmingly support. This status quo arrangement is a special interest orchestrated farce to the detriment of the citizens. Judicial reform passed the House with strong support. Republican voters across this state want it. Yet it sits, blocked, because of one man.  When I am elected governor, I will use the full weight of my office and my influence to ensure that this kind of obstruction ends.  I further propose that the Senate majority leader also have an expiration date. Again, my preference is 2 years. We need new blood and new perspectives in leadership. When you have a set time as leader you do not get complacent but instead strive to be consequential. The Senate majority leader, and all leaders for that matter, must be very aware that they serve the people not themselves.  I am not worried about this new system ousting great Chairman like Harvey Peeler for example because Harvey is a true patriot and the kind of leader a committee would be stupid not to elect. He's a man who ethically leads with honesty and isn't controlled by special interests. Enough already. It is time to go back to the founding principles of 1776 where elected officials protect our God given rights not their personal interests and the interests of their donors. It's time for something different.
